Comstock Mobile Home Fire Kills Woman as Authorities Investigate
Investigators are examining the Highway 63 blaze that claimed resident Dawn Allen.
Overview
- Deputies responded around 3:18 p.m. on Oct. 30 to a mobile home on the 1800 block of U.S. Highway 63 in Comstock.
- After crews extinguished the fire, they found the body of resident Dawn Allen inside the home.
- The response included the Barron County Sheriff’s Office, Cumberland Fire Department, Cumberland Ambulance and the Wisconsin Department of Justice.
- Officials have not released a cause for the fire, and the inquiry remains active.
- Authorities said no additional information is available at this time.
